Veneers are thin shells made from porcelain that are bonded to the front of your teeth. They hide imperfections such as stains, chips, cracks, gaps between teeth, or uneven tooth position. What Types of Problems Can Veneers Fix?

  • Teeth that are misaligned
  • Teeth stained by food, coffee, tobacco, etc.
  • Chips or cracks in the outermost layer of the teeth
  • Misshapen or uneven teeth
  • Gapped teeth
  • Uneven gum lines
  • Chipped or worn teeth

The Procedure for Cosmetic Veneers

The process for placing veneers generally takes two appointments to complete. The teeth are prepped for veneer placement during the first appointment by removing a thin enamel layer. Impressions are taken and sent to the lab to fabricate the veneers. A temporary covering will be placed on the tooth while the permanent veneer is created. 

Once the veneer is ready, the temporary restoration is removed, and the permanent veneer is placed using a special curing light to bond it to the tooth permanently.

Since veneers are made from porcelain, they resist staining from foods and drinks containing dark pigments. However, it is still important to continue brushing and flossing daily to prolong the life of the veneers and avoid potential decay that can occur when bacteria and plaque are allowed to build up on the teeth. Additionally, it is essential to maintain regular dental checkups and cleanings to ensure that the health of the teeth and gums is also maintained.

The Benefits of Cosmetic Veneers 

The main benefit of cosmetic veneers is the aesthetic enhancement they provide to a flawed smile. A veneer is a thin shell of porcelain placed over a tooth's surface to cover chips, cracks, misalignment, stains, and other superficial imperfections. They can dramatically transform the appearance of a smile. 

Patients often experience a boost in self-confidence and feel more attractive and confident in their personal and professional relationships after performing the procedure. Additionally, the porcelain material used to make veneers mimics the natural translucence of tooth enamel for a seamless and natural look.

Another benefit of veneers is that they are durable restorations that will last many years with proper care. With good oral hygiene habits, they can last for up to ten years. Therefore, they are an excellent option for patients seeking a more long-term solution to their cosmetic concerns.
